Key Features — Nikon 28mm f/1.8G
28mm f/1.8 Prime: A fixed wide-angle focal length with a fast maximum aperture, ideal for low-light shooting and selective depth-of-field control.
Full-Frame Nikon F Mount: Covers a full-frame image circle and is compatible with the full range of Nikon F-mount DSLR bodies, including APS-C cameras.
AF-S Silent Wave Motor: Built-in Silent Wave Motor delivers fast, quiet autofocus that is well-suited for both stills and video use.
Manual Focus Override: Full-time manual focus override allows instant switching from autofocus without changing any camera settings.
Compact 330g Build: At just 330g, this lens is lightweight enough for comfortable all-day handheld use in street, travel, and documentary shooting.
67mm Filter Thread: A widely available filter size that makes it straightforward to pair with polarizers, ND filters, and other common accessories.

Description — Nikon 28mm f/1.8G
The Nikon AF-S NIKKOR 28mm f/1.8G is a wide-angle prime lens built around the Nikon F mount with full-frame coverage. Its f/1.8 maximum aperture makes it a capable choice when shooting in challenging light, while the fixed 28mm focal length encourages a disciplined approach to composition. Both autofocus and manual focus are supported, offering flexibility across a range of shooting styles and subjects.
At just 330g, it is light enough to carry all day without fatigue. The 67mm filter thread is compatible with a wide range of readily available filter options. Note that this lens does not include image stabilization, so steady shooting in low light will depend on aperture advantage and technique.
